Thomaatje Posted October 24, 2019 Share Posted October 24, 2019 On 10/12/2019 at 1:42 PM, Zylla said: SSLsplit + ModuleWorking on the latest firmware > v2.5.4 Package / IPK (For advanced users): You can now find SSLSplit v0.5.5 on my github repo. 😉 It's been compiled for the latest firmwares, and is working flawlessly for me, on both my Nano and Tetra! 🙂 Manual installation of the package is for advanced users. The Module: I've also created a fork of the original SSLsplit Module, that you can find on a separate github. repo: https://github.com/adde88/SSLsplitNG It's been modified to install my package, and should work on firmware versions > 2.6.0 Module Installation: Download this tarball containing the module, and transfer it to your Pineapples /tmp directory, for example by using WinSCP, or "scp" on Linux. SSH to your Pineapple and run the commands below exactly as outlined. cd /tmp gunzip SSLsplitNG-1.6.tar.gz tar -xvf SSLsplitNG-1.6.tar cd SSLsplitNG-1.6 mkdir -p /pineapple/modules/SSLsplitNG cp -r * /pineapple/modules/SSLsplitNG/ I'd appreciate feedback, especially if you encounter any errors! Zylla Posted December 21, 2019 Author Share Posted December 21, 2019 13 hours ago, Sarif said: Not working here. I can install the module following the instructions, but SSLstrip will not start. running sslsplit -h shows the following error: Error loading shared library libfts.so.0: No such file or directory (needed by /sd/usr/bin/sslsplit) Error relocating /sd/usr/bin/sslsplit: fts_read: symbol not found Error relocating /sd/usr/bin/sslsplit: fts_close: symbol not found Error relocating /sd/usr/bin/sslsplit: fts_open: symbol not found Error relocating /sd/usr/bin/sslsplit: fts_set: symbol not found Is there a dependency missing in dependency.sh? Every single dependency is accounted for in the script. The dependency that seems to be missing in your installation is "musl-fts". This will happen most often if the Pineapple doesn't have a working internet connection while installing, or if "opkg update" has not been run / is not working. Easiest fix would be to run this one liner over SSH: "opkg update ; opkg install musl-fts -d sd"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
